| Executive Compensation Objectives | | | • Attracting, motivating and retaining key talent; • Tying compensation to the achievement of key short- and long-term objectives, including the Company’s Core FFO per share, Core Adjusted FFO per share, and specific strategic performance goals, in the case of the annual cash incentive program, and absolute and relative total shareholder return (“TSR”), in the case of the long-term incentive program; and • Aligning management’s interests with those of stockholders. | |
| Factors Guiding Compensation Decisions | | | • Performance against pre-established short- and long-term objectives aligned with the Strategic Plan; • Stockholder feedback; • General market pay and governance practices; and • Mitigating compensation risk. | |
| Summary of 2019 Compensation Program for Mr. DeMarco, our Chief Executive Officer | | | • No increase in base salary for 2019; • Total compensation opportunities targeted at levels that are generally comparable to target total compensation levels for the chief executive officer of the Peer Group REITs (as defined below in the Compensation Discussion and Analysis under the heading “Process for Determining Compensation”); • Eighty percent (80%) of the annual cash incentive plan award based on pre-determined financial performance objectives, which align compensation with key annual financial metrics (e.g., Core FFO and Core Adjusted FFO), and the remaining twenty percent (20%) based on certain non-financial strategic goals approved by the Compensation Committee; | |
| | | | • Seventy-five percent (75%) of target long-term equity incentive awards allocated to performance-based long-term incentive plan (“LTIP”) Units, granted under a multi-year, outperformance plan (the “2019 OPP”), under which the full awards will only be earned if, over the three-year performance period, the Company achieves a thirty-six percent (36%) absolute TSR and if the Company is at or above the 75th percentile of TSR versus a peer group comprised of the equity office REITs in the NAREIT Equity Office Index. Fifty percent (50%) of awards earned based on performance are subject to an additional two-year ratable service-vesting period; • Twenty-five percent (25%) of target long-term equity incentive awards allocated to time-based LTIP Units that cliff-vest at the end of three years; and • In connection with the execution of a new employment agreement, a special award of 625,000 performance-based, “appreciation only” LTIP Units (“Class AO LTIP Units”). Class AO LTIP Units are similar to stock options in that they only have value to the extent the stock price appreciates above the grant price. In addition, certain stock price hurdles beginning at 16.5% above the grant price must be achieved for thirty consecutive trading days within four years of the grant for the special Class AO LTIP Units to vest. | |
